网站开发后台:构建高效管理的核心引擎
在数字化时代,网站开发后台作为支撑前端展示的“大脑”,其重要性不言而喻。无论是企业官网、电商平台还是内容管理系统,一个稳定、安全且易用的后台能大幅提升运营效率。本文将深入探讨网站开发后台的关键要素,帮助开发者和管理者优化技术选型与工作流程。
1. 后台开发的技术选型与框架
选择合适的开发框架是后台搭建的第一步。主流技术如PHP的Laravel、Python的Django或Node.js的Express,各有优势。例如,Laravel适合快速开发中小型项目,而Django凭借其ORM和安全性,更适合数据密集型应用。微服务架构的兴起让Spring Cloud等方案成为高并发场景的热门选择。开发者需根据项目规模、团队技能和长期维护成本综合考量。
2. 数据库设计与性能优化
数据库是后台的核心组件。MySQL、PostgreSQL等关系型数据库适合结构化数据,而MongoDB等NoSQL数据库则擅长处理灵活的非结构化数据。设计时需遵循规范化原则,同时通过索引、分表或缓存(如Redis)提升查询速度。例如,电商后台的订单表可结合读写分离策略,避免高峰期宕机。
3. 权限管理与安全防护
后台安全直接关系企业数据资产。采用RBAC(基于角色的访问控制)模型可精细化分配权限,如管理员、编辑员等角色。需防范SQL注入、XSS攻击等常见威胁,通过参数化查询、CSRF令牌和HTTPS加密传输提升安全性。定期审计日志和漏洞扫描同样不可或缺。
4. 用户体验与运维监控
后台的易用性常被忽视,但直接影响运营效率。清晰的UI布局、批量操作功能和数据导出选项能节省大量时间。集成Prometheus或ELK栈等监控工具,可实时追踪服务器负载、API响应速度等指标,确保系统稳定运行。
后台开发的关键在于平衡功能与效率
网站开发后台不仅是技术实现的集合,更是业务逻辑的载体。从技术选型到安全防护,每个环节都需围绕实际需求展开。未来,随着AI和低代码平台的普及,后台开发将更智能化,但核心目标始终不变:为前端提供可靠、高效的数据与服务支撑。













京公网安备11000000000001号
京ICP备11000001号
还没有评论,来说两句吧...